Postlethwait Rw is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Gastroenterology. According to data from OpenAlex, Postlethwait Rw has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 476 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Surgery, 8 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 3 papers in Gastroenterology. Recurrent topics in Postlethwait Rw’s work include Helicobacter pylori-related gastroenterology studies (4 papers), Surgical Sutures and Adhesives (4 papers) and Esophageal and GI Pathology (3 papers). Postlethwait Rw is often cited by papers focused on Helicobacter pylori-related gastroenterology studies (4 papers), Surgical Sutures and Adhesives (4 papers) and Esophageal and GI Pathology (3 papers).
